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Відповіді на білети.doc
Скачиваний:
0
Добавлен:
01.07.2025
Размер:
1.24 Mб
Скачать
  1. Практичне завдання на створення діаграми у середовищі табличного процесора.

Білет № 7

  1. Основні поняття бази даних. Типи даних, що зберігаються в базі даних. Проектування бази даних і створення структури бази даних.Основні команди для роботи з таблицями

Визначення бази даних, основні властивості реляційної моделі бази даних див. у білеті № 6(1)..

База даних (БД) — в Access це файл, який служить для зберігання даних, об'єктів та настроювань СУБД. Зазвичай БД створюється для однієї конкретної прикладної задачі.

Таблиця — основний об'єкт БД, сховище інформації.

Запит (на вибірку) — засіб відбору даних з однієї або декількох таблиць за допомогою певного користувача умови. Запити дозволяють створювати віртуальні таблиці, які складаються з полів, що обчислюються, або полів, узятих з інших таблиць. В Access існує кілька типів запитів (див. білет №17(2)).

Форма — засіб відображення даних на екрані й управління ними.

Звіт — засіб відображення даних при виведенні на друк.

Запис — аналог рядка в таблиці. Запис є стандартним блоком для зберігай-, ня даних у таблиці, вибірці даних у запиті, формі, що виводиться на екран, і т. д.

Поле — стовпець у таблиці. В Access полю надається ряд властивостей, які визначають можливості БД.

Ключове поле щ—поле, значення якого служать для однозначного визна­чення запису в таблиці.

Ключ — одне або кілька ключових полів, які дозволяють ідентифікувати записи таблиці або організувати зв'язки між таблицями.

Конструктор — режим визначення властивостей об'єктів БД (таблиць, запитів, форм, звітів, макросів, модулів). Конструктор має своє вікно, у яко­му розташована таблиця для завдання властивостей об'єкта — бланк. Режим конструктора є альтернативою режиму перегляду даних.

Майстер — програма, націлена на розв'язання певної вузької задачі. Майстри ведуть діалог із користувачем, у процесі якого додаток одержує необхідні відомості для розв'язання задачі. Для зручності робота Майстра складається з декількох етапів або кроків. Користувач у разі необхідності може повернутися до попереднього кроку або пропустити непотрібний. Включення в програму Майстрів — один із засобів модернізації програмних продуктів.

Вдала розробка БД забезпечує простоту її підтримки. Дані слід зберігати в таблицях, причому кожна таблиця має містити інформацію одного типу, наприклад відомості про замовників. Тоді достатньо буде обновити конкретні дані, такі як адреса, тільки в одному місцЦщоб обновлена інформація відоб­ражалася у всій БД.

Правильно спроектована БД зазвичай містить різноманітні запити, що дозволяють відображати потрібну інформацію. Перш ніж приступити в Microsoft Access до фактичної розробки таблиць, запитів, форм та інших об'єктів, рекомендується попередньо спланувати структуру на папері.

Розробка БД розподіляється на такі основні етапи;

  • розробка й опис структур таблиць даних;

  • розробка схеми даних і завдання системи взаємозв'язків між таблицями;

  • розробка системи запитів до таблиць БД і (за необхідності) їхня інтеграція в схему даних;

  • розробка екранних форм уведення/виведення даних;

  • розробка системи звітів;

  • розробка програмних розширень для БД, що вирішують специфічні зада­чі з опрацювання інформації, яка міститься в ній, за допомогою інстру­ментарію макросів і модулів;

— розробка системи захисту даних, прав і обмежень щодо доступу. Приклад проектування бази даних див. у білеті № 19(3). Створення БД Microsoft Access. В Microsoft Access підтримуються два

способи створення БД. Можна скористатися майстром БД для створення всіх необхідних таблиць, форм і звітів для БД обраного типу — це найпростіший спосіб початкового створення БД. Є також можливість створити порожню БД, а потім додати до неї таблиці, форми, звіти й інші об'єкти — це найбільш гнучкий спосіб, але він вимагає окремого визначення кожного елемента БД. В обох випадках створену БД можна в будь-який час змінити й розширити.

Microsoft Access дозволяє управляти всіма відомостями з одного файлу БД. У рамках цього файлу використовуються такі об'єкти: таблиці для збе­реження даних; запити для пошуку й вилучення тільки необхідних даних; форми для перегляду, додавання й зміни даних у таблицях; звіти для аналізу й друку данихоу певному форматі; сторінки доступу до даних для перегляду, відновленняй аналізу даних з БД через Інтернет або інтрамережу.

Основним структурним компонентом БД є таблиця. У таблицях зберіга­ються значення, що вводять. Якщо записів у таблиці поки немає, то її струк­тура утворена тільки набором полів. Змінивши склад полів базової таблиці (або їхньої властивості), можна змінити структуру даних і, відповідно, одер­жати нову БД.

Таблиця містить набір даних за конкретною темою. Використання окремої таблиці для кожної теми означає, що відповідні дані збережені лише один раз, що робить БД більш ефективною й знижує число помилок під час уведен­ня даних. Способи створення таблиць, заповнення й редагування даних див. у білеті № 20(2).

Кожному полю відповідає певний тип даних. Його можна вибрати зі спи­ску стовпця Тип даних, що розкривається. Access розрізняє такі типи даних: текстовий, поле Мето, числовий, дата/час, грошовий, лічильник, логічний, поле об'єкта OLE, гіперпосилання.

Для виділеної таблиці можна виконати команди, надані в контекстному меню. Таблицю можна відкрити в режимі таблиці й конструктора; вивести на друк; подивитися на екрані, як вона буде виглядати на папері; вирізати; ско­піювати; зберегти як таблицю, форму, звіт, сторінку доступу; експортувати в інші формати БД, як книгу Excel; видалити; перейменувати; ознайомитися з її властивостями.

Відкриту таблицю можна формату вати, змінити шрифт, висоту й ширину стовпця, оформлення таблиці, перейменувати стовпці, сховати, відобразити стовпці. До записів таблиці можна застосувати фільтр, впорядкування (див. білет № 11(2)). І Можна видалити запис, стовпець таблиці, вставити підтаблицю.

В Access можна задати три види зв'язків між таблицями: Одиндо-багатьох, Багато-до-багатьох і Один-до-одного.

Зв'язок Одиндо-багатьох — найчастіше використовуваний тип зв'язку між таблицями, у такому зв'язку кожному запису в таблиці А може відповідати кілька записів у таблиці В (поля із цими і записами називаються зовнішніми ключами), а запис у таблиці В не може мати більше ніж один відповідний їй запис у таблиці А.

У випадку зв'язку Багато-до-багатьох одному запису в таблиці А може відповідати кілька записів . у таблиці В, а одному запису в таблиці В — кілька записів у таблиці А. Така схема реалізується тільки за допомогою третьої (зв'язаної) таблиці, ключ і якої складається принаймні із двох полів, одне з яких є спільним із таблицею А, а інший — спільним із таблицею В.

У випадку зв'язку Один-до-одного запис у таблиці А може мати не більше і від одного зв'язаного запису в таблиці В, і навпаки. Цей тип зв'язку використовують не дуже часто, оскільки такі дані можуть бути поміщені в одну і таблицю. Зв'язок з відношенням Один-до-одного застосовують для розподілу дуже широких таблиць, для відокремлення частини таблиці з метою її захи­сту, а також для збереження відомостей, які належать до підмножини записів у головній таблиці.

Висновки. Створення реляційної БД за допомогою СУБД починається із визначення структури таблиць. Потім створюється схема даних, у якій установлюються зв'язки між таблицями. Завершується створення БД про­ цедурою завантаження (заповненням таблиць конкретною інформацією).

  1. Загальні принципи створення компۥютерної презентації.